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Brockton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Brockton with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Brockton is at Davis Commons listed at $2,050.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Brockton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Brockton is $3,066.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Brockton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Brockton is a 2,500 square feet unit starting from $5,300 at Water Pointe.

What is the average size for Brockton 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Brockton is currently 1,545 sq ft.
